About the Conductor

Maestro Louis Panacciulli

Maestro Louis Panacciulli has been the Music Director and Conductor of The Nassau Pops Symphony Orchestra since 1984. He received his Bachelor's Degree in Music from Pace University and has the distinction of being the first graduate to have received this degree in a unique cooperative program with New York University. Mr. Panacciulli also attended The Mannes College of Music, and in 1973 received his Master's Degree from New York University. He is currently an active member of major music and educational organizations on Long Island.

In 1987, Maestro Panacciulli founded The Nassau Pops Wind Ensemble, a thirty-eight member symphonic band. He is also a Professor on the Adjunct Music Faculty of The Nassau Community College where he conducts its Concert Band. This band is open to all Nassau County musicians.

In addition to his busy conducting schedule, he can often be found performing as a clarinet soloist and as a member of several wind ensembles, concert bands, and orchestras in New York City as well as Long Island. NPSO co-founder Dawn Simmons Manuel and he regularly collaborate as music directors for many of Long Island's fine musical theater presentations.

About the Orchestra

The Nassau Pops Symphony Orchestra was founded in 1984 to bring light classical and popular music to Long Island. Since then, it has become known for musical excellence, community service, and free summer concerts across Nassau County, collaborating with major artists and causes.
